Maractus is a Grass-type Pokémon card with 90 HP from the Dragons Exalted set, part of the Black & White series. It carries the collector number 16/124 and is classified as Uncommon. The Dragons Exalted set was released on August 15, 2012.
The card includes the flavor text: “Arid regions are their habitat. They move rhythmically, making a sound similar to maracas.”.

Whether Maractus is worth grading comes down to condition. Before submitting a card, collectors usually check front and back centring, corner sharpness, edge wear, surface defects, and any print lines or factory imperfections.
Across the hobby, top grades such as PSA 10, BGS/Beckett 9.5–10, and CGC Pristine 10 generally command a premium over raw or lower-graded copies.
PSA has graded 3 copies of this card, of which 0 earned a PSA 10 — a gem rate of about 0.0%. These population figures were last refreshed on June 15, 2026. Population counts only rise as more copies are submitted, so the gem rate and totals shift over time; nothing here is estimated or back-filled.
